首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[分享]css动态酷炫步骤组件

发布于 2024-11-11 15:17:49
0
55

CSS动态酷炫步骤组件是一种可以帮助我们快速搭建Web页面流程展示的工具。比如,我们可以将一个网站用户注册流程拆分成多个步骤,然后通过CSS动态效果来实现页面步骤之间的切换和展示。下面我们来看看怎样使...

CSS动态酷炫步骤组件是一种可以帮助我们快速搭建Web页面流程展示的工具。比如,我们可以将一个网站用户注册流程拆分成多个步骤,然后通过CSS动态效果来实现页面步骤之间的切换和展示。下面我们来看看怎样使用这个组件。

 <!-- HTML代码 -->
  <div class="steps">
    <div class="step active">步骤一</div>
    <div class="step">步骤二</div>
    <div class="step">步骤三</div>
    <div class="step">步骤四</div>
  </div>

  /* CSS样式 */
  .steps {
    display: flex;
    justify-content: space-between;
    align-items: center;
    width: 100%;
  }

  .step {
    border-radius: 50%;
    width: 40px;
    height: 40px;
    background-color: #ccc;
    color: #fff;
    text-align: center;
    line-height: 40px;
    cursor: pointer;
    transition: all 0.3s ease-in-out;
  }

  .step.active {
    background-color: #f44336;
    transform: scale(1.2);
  } 

上面的HTML代码中,我们将一个步骤组件定义为一个包含多个步骤的

元素。每个步骤都是一个

元素,并通过设置CSS样式实现步骤之间的切换效果和鼠标悬停动画效果。同时,在CSS样式中,我们也设置了步骤组件整体的排列方式和尺寸大小等。

通过这种方式,我们可以灵活地定义Web页面的步骤展示过程,让页面看起来更加动态和有吸引力。同时,我们还可以根据实际需要,结合JavaScript代码实现更加复杂的动态效果和逻辑控制。

评论
一个月内的热帖推荐
91云脑
Lv.1普通用户

62849

帖子

14

小组

291

积分

赞助商广告
站长交流